  • the present invention relates to a joining and levelling device for parts of furniture and furnishing items.
  • figures 1, 2 and 3 show a known solution of a joining device for parts of furniture and furnishing items, for example between a shoulder of a piece of furniture and a base, or in any case a shelf.
  • holings must be provided in both a shoulder 11 and a base 12 of a piece of furniture, both partially shown in a connection part of the same.
  • the shoulder 11 in fact, provides a horizontal blind holing 13 and the base 12 provides even a double holing 14, 15. More specifically, a horizontal holing 14 to be aligned with the holing 13 of the shoulder 11, and a vertical holing 15, formed in the upper surface of the base 12, which intersects the first holing 14, for the insertion of a blocking element, for example a grub screw 16, wherein both holings are blind.
  • Said holing 13 has an axis A which is perpendicular to the shoulder 11.
  • This known joining device provides the positioning of a pin 17 with a first threaded end 18 inside an internally threaded bush 19 positioned in the holing 13 of the shoulder 11.
  • the pin 17 contains, at the other end 20, a housing 21 for an end of the grub screw 16.
  • a bush 22 is housed in the vertical holing 15 of the base 12, which provides a horizontal pass-through hole 23 for receiving the protruding end 20 of the pin 17 and a vertical threaded pass-through hole 24 which receives the grub screw 16.
  • the grub screw 16 is then screwed, with a tool 25, according to the arrow 26, into the bush 22 so that the tip of the grub screw 16 is positioned in the housing 21 provided at the free end 20 of the pin 17.
  • the blocking group is in the base, it is arranged perpendicular to the base and to the movement or approach direction and tightening between the shoulder and base. Only the pin, with which the blocking group cooperates, is provided in the thickness of the shoulder or side panel.
  • Said figure 3 indicates, by means of a series of arrows, the scheme of forces at play between the shoulder 11 and base 12 of the piece of furniture and between the parts of the joining device.
  • This final position also shows how the end of the holing 15 is present on the upper surface of the base 12, which is normally covered with a closing cap (not shown) .
  • Said holing and the corresponding cap form a visible part of the joining device.
  • this part does not have an aesthetically valid appearance as, although there is the presence of the cap, it shows how the joining has been effected.
  • the cap itself which is difficult to be brought specifically in line with the surface of the base, represents an obstacle for the insertion of any object, creating a protrusion, even if minimum, with respect to the upper surface of the base.
  • the general objective of the present invention is to provide a joining device between parts of furniture and furnishing items, such as a shoulder and a base, capable of solving the drawbacks of the known art indicated above, in an extremely simple, economical and particularly functional manner.
  • a further objective of the present invention is to provide a joining device between parts of furniture and furnishing items, such as a shoulder and a base, which is not visible to an observer and therefore has a high aesthetical value.
  • Another objective of the present invention is to provide a joining device between parts of furniture and furnishing items, such as a shoulder and a base, which does not have any protrusion with respect to the upper surface of the base.
  • Yet another objective of the present invention is to provide a joining device between parts of furniture and furnishing items, such as a shoulder and a base, that also allows a levelling action, minimizing the elements involved in order to also achieve the previous objective of minimizing the visibility of the joining device and that of the levelling device previously indicated .

  • the joining device must connect and join a first panel 11, for example a shoulder 11 of a piece of furniture together with a second panel 12 and with a third panel 12', each for example in the form of a base or in any case a shelf, partially shown in the figures.
  • a first panel 11 for example a shoulder 11 of a piece of furniture together with a second panel 12 and with a third panel 12', each for example in the form of a base or in any case a shelf, partially shown in the figures.
  • the shoulder 11 and the bases or panels 12, 12' are generally perpendicular to each other but they may also be tilted with respect to each other.
  • the two bases or panels 12, 12' are essentially similar as are also the parts of the device that are inserted therein. For the sake of simplicity, only one part relating to a first panel or base 12 will be described as the parts for the other base 12' are analogous both in the panel or base and in the parts of the device positioned therein.
  • the base 12 or 12' contains, at one of its ends, a seat S2 in the form of a horizontal blind holing 30 in which an internally threaded bush 31 is positioned for receiving a threaded end 32 of a screw with an enlarged head 50, which has the function of a pin.
  • the screw 50 In a part between the threaded end 32 and the enlarged head, the screw 50, in its part protruding from the panel 12, defines an annular housing 73 for a rotatable circular element 52 forming part of the joining device.
  • connection group GC to be firmly blocked for stably interconnecting said shoulder 11 and said base 12 on the one hand, and said shoulder 11 and said other base 12' on the other hand, as explained in greater detail hereunder .
  • the shoulder 11 provides a seat SI - for a blocking group GB and for a levelling group GL -, having a substantially elongated configuration, in the form of a vertical blind holing 36 which intersects with a first and a second horizontal blind holing 37, 38, spaced from each other, formed in this example on both sides of the shoulder 11 and aligned with each other. Furthermore, if only one base is to be connected with the shoulder 11, there is only one arrangement as described above.
  • the seat SI characteristically extends from a perimetric lower edge Bl towards the interior of the shoulder or panel 11.
  • a pair of half-shells 39, 40, are housed in the vertical holing 36, that form a cylindrical casing in a part of which the blocking group GB and the levelling group GL are housed.
  • the blocking group GB provides a rotatable circular element 52, with a thickness of a peripheral edge having a variable dimension 74 acting as a cam for engagement, when rotated, with the annular housing 73 of the screw with an enlarged head 50.
  • the rotatable circular element 52 is positioned in a circular seat 75 complementarily grooved in a side portion of the respective half-shell 39 or/and 40.
  • the rotatable element 52 is kept in the seat 75 by a cap 76 centrally provided with a hole 77.
  • the rotatable circular element 52 also has a central hole 78 with which an outwardly enlarged seat 79 is associated (with two diametrically opposite grooves) for a flat tip 80 of a screwdriver 81.
  • the levelling group GL is also housed in an internal part towards the bottom of the two half-shells 39, 40.
  • a pinion 41 is rotatingly positioned inside a hole 42 formed in one of the two half-shells 39, which is aligned with the first horizontal holing 37 of the shoulder 11.
  • the pinion 41 is engaged with a toothed crown 43, formed as head of a threaded screw 44, and can rotate in a seat 45 formed in the two coupled half-shells 39 and 40.
  • the threaded screw 44 is in turn positioned in a threaded axial hole 46 and inside a supporting leg 82 on a floor P.
  • Said components 41, 43, 44, 46, 82 define the levelling group GL which cooperates according to the invention with both the blocking group GB and also with the connection group GC .
  • FIGS 4 to 7 show how this collaboration takes place between the various groups indicated.
  • the parts of the joining device according to the present invention are first of all positioned, inserting the two half-shells 39 and 40 on the one hand in the holing 36 of the shoulder 11 after positioning the various elements described above in their interior.
  • Each screw with an enlarged head 50 of the respective connection group GC is positioned in the holing 30 of the respective base 12, 12', as shown in figure 4.
  • each base 12, 12' is then moved towards the two surfaces S on opposite sides of the shoulder 11, inserting the protruding part of the screw with an enlarged head 50 in the second horizontal holing 38 of the shoulder 11 (figure 5) .
  • the flat tip 80 of the screwdriver 81 is subsequently inserted in the seat 79 (with two diametrically opposite grooves) present in the respective rotatable circular element 52 of the blocking group GB .
  • the screwdriver 81 is rotated according to the arrow 83 causing the rotatable circular element 52 to rotate in its seat 75 so as to allow the engagement of the peripheral edge 74 having a greater thickness and acting as a cam, in the annular housing 73 of the screw with an enlarged head 50.
  • Figures 12 to 14 show this type of operation in detail, illustrating the rotating element 52 and the screwdriver 81 in their operations in various consecutive actuation phases of this part of the joining and levelling device of the invention.
  • the joining is thus obtained by operating on both the blocking group GB and on the two connection groups GC.
  • the levelling of the furniture with respect to the floor P can also be effected by acting on the levelling group GL, which is also included and incorporated according to the present invention directly inside the two half-shells 39, 40.
  • a shaped tool 47 such as a hexagonal key, is inserted according to the arrow 84 inside a complementary seat formed axially in the pinion 41 passing through the first holing 37 of the shoulder 11 so as to enable its rotation .
  • the rotation of the pinion 41 in turn causes the rotation of the toothed crown 43 formed in the head of the threaded screw 44.
  • the rotation of the threaded screw 44 forces the downward movement of the supporting leg 82 to reach the floor P, thanks to the collaboration with the threaded axial hole 46 and inside the leg 82.
  • the leg 82 is equipped with blocking means 82A, 82B against rotation (anti- rotational form) , which allow the translation of the leg 82 itself, preventing its rotation.
  • the means 82A can consist, for example, of radial protrusions that are coupled inside corresponding seats 82B of the half- shells 39, 40.
  • both the blocking group GB and the levelling group GL are inserted inside said seat SI that is contained in the thickness SP of the shoulder 11.
  • the joining and levelling device of the present invention essentially comprises a blocking group GB inserted inside a seat SI or elongated vertical holing 36 of the shoulder 11 which acts on a pair of screw 50 connection groups GC to be blocked, each positioned inside a seat S2 of the relative base 12, 12' and which extends from a horizontal holing 30 formed laterally with respect to the base 12 , 12 ' .

  • any possible caps positioned in the holings do not interfere with what is resting on the base of the furniture that is free of any type of holing .
  • the elimination of holes that intersect with each other in the base eliminates or at least minimizes any possible weakening of the base itself that can therefore sustain high loads without the danger of a possible cause of breakage of the base.
  • the levelling is effected with elements that are kept compact in the same device.

La présente invention concerne un dispositif d'assemblage et de nivellement pour parties de meubles et articles d'ameublement, en particulier entre un premier panneau (11) et une paire de deuxièmes panneaux (12, 12') placés sur des côtés en regard par rapport audit premier panneau (11) et devant être déplacés l'un vers l'autre selon une direction d'approche (d, d') afin d'amener le bord (B) de ladite paire de panneaux (12, 12') en butée dans une position de serrage contre une surface (S) de l'autre panneau (11), ledit dispositif de raccordement étant constitué de groupes de blocage (GB) et de groupes de liaison (GC) assemblés sur lesdits panneaux (11, 12, 12'). Le dispositif est caractérisé en ce qu'un groupe de nivellement (GL) est également inséré à l'intérieur d'un même siège (S1) du premier panneau (11) contenant également lesdits groupes de blocage (GB) et lesdits groupes de liaison (GC), ledit siège (S1) étant contenu dans une épaisseur (SP) du premier panneau (11), ledit siège (S1) possédant un axe longitudinal (X) perpendiculaire à ladite direction (d, d'), et s'étendant depuis un bord (B1) vers l'intérieur dudit premier panneau (11), lesdits groupes de blocage (GB) et lesdits groupes de liaison (GC) étant placés sur des côtés en regard par rapport audit groupe de nivellement (GL) et agissant sur chacun desdits deuxièmes panneaux (12, 12').
